What is Beauty Therapy?

Beauty therapy is a diverse industry that involves the application of a large variety of beauty treatments, mainly for the purpose of improving physical appearances. Beauty Therapy involves the treatment of hair, skin and nails, and can include make-up application, eyelash and eyebrow shaping, manicures, pedicures, nail extensions, hairstyling, hair removal, body massage, and non-surgical skin therapies.

 

Beauty therapy as a field of study aims to prepare students for working in this industry. It involves learning how to perform various treatments, as well as learning about physiology and anatomy, as it is important for beauty therapists to understand the scientific principles underlying the treatments that they administer to their clients.

Careers in Beauty Therapy:

A career in beauty therapy can be highly rewarding for people who enjoy practical work, and who are keen to help other people to feel good about themselves. Qualified beauty therapists can work all over the world, and can find employment opportunities in a variety of places. They can, for example, work in beauty salons, on cruise ships, at health resorts and spas, or at beauty academies. They also have the option of working as freelancers. Beauty therapists are also needed to work on movie sets, behind the scenes for on-stage productions, and in the world of fashion and modelling.

 

Careers in beauty therapy are diverse, and offer the potential for flexible working hours and part-time employment. With enough work experience, a qualified beauty therapist could also take up a management role, or start up his or her own beauty salon.

 

Possible careers in the field of beauty therapy include:

 

    • Beauty therapist

    • Beautician

    • Nail technician

    • Make-up artist

    • Hair stylist

    • Facial skin care therapist

    • Massage therapist

    • Retail cosmetics assistant

    • Salon manager

    • Lash and brow specialist
